Broadway’s ‘Lempicka’ will perform at Sotheby’sSotheby’s, the British-founded auction house for fine art, jewelry and collectibles, will host a performance from the cast of the upcoming Rachel Chavkin helmed Broadway musical “Lempicka.” A first of its kind for the centuries-old institution, the performance will take place on Jan. 17 at the Sotheby’s Upper East Side location on 1334 York Avenue. 

Eden Espinosa, who is set to play the titular character in the new musical about Polish art deco painter Tamara de Lempicka, will serve as host of the invitation-only event. However, the general public is invited to enter a free lottery on the TodayTix app for a chance to attend. Sotheby’s has also announced an event titled “The World of Tamara — A Celebration of ‘Lempicka’ and Art Deco.” The auction and exhibition will feature art by Lempicka as well as other art deco works. The selling exhibition will open on March 28 and run through April 16.  www.lempickamusical.com
